Don't be too disappointed if the scent of the tea doesn't come through. The lye monster may be a little tough on the tea. Using spearmint and peppermint EO's wold reinforce the scent nicely.

If you add the leaves - they will probably turn dark brown eventually - but you could start with a tsp up to a TBLSP per pound of oils depending on the effect you want.
